什么是tpWallet?

tpWallet是一款支持多种区块链的数字钱包,允许用户安全地存储、管理和交易不同类型的加密货币。它不仅仅是一个简单的货币钱包,还具备支持智能合约的功能,使得开发者能够在钱包中集成和管理他们的合约。tpWallet专注于用户体验,提供了简单的操作界面和强大的功能,吸引了数量庞大的用户。

合约上架的基本步骤

合约上架到tpWallet的过程可以划分为几个关键步骤:

  1. 准备合约代码:确保你的合约已经经过充分的测试,并且满足tpWallet平台的技术标准。合约代码应当是高效的,安全的,且便于用户理解和使用。
  2. 创建合约:在 Ethereum 或其他支持的链上创建你的合约。使用Solidity等合约语言编写,完成代码后,通过适当的工具(比如 Remix IDE)进行编译和部署。
  3. 注册合约信息:需要在tpWallet的官方网站或者相关的开发者平台上注册你的合约信息。提供合约的地址、名称、符号等基本信息。
  4. 测试合约功能:在正式上架前,建议通过测试网络对合约进行更多的测试,确保其兼容性和稳定性。测试合约在试验区块链上是完全免费的,能让你发现潜在的问题。
  5. 提交上架申请:按照tpWallet的要求,提交合约的上架申请。需要确保提供所有相关的文档和信息,如合约验证文件、使用说明等。
  6. 等待审核:tpWallet团队将会对合约进行审核,确保其安全性和兼容性。审核时间因合约不同而有所差异。
  7. 合约上线:审核通过后,合约将会在tpWallet上正式上线,用户便可以开始使用和交易该合约对应的数字资产。

如何确保合约的安全性?

安全性是合约开发和上架中最重要的一环。合约一旦部署到区块链上,就无法修改,存在漏洞或者安全隐患将可能对用户带来财务损失。

为确保合约的安全性,可以采取以下几种方法:

  1. 代码审计:通过第三方的专业团队进行合约的安全审计。他们会对代码进行深入剖析,找出潜在的安全问题,并提供整改建议。
  2. 单元测试:编写完合约后,进行充分的单元测试,确保每一个功能模块都能正确运行,对于可能出现的边界情况进行模拟。
  3. 向社区反馈:在合约上线之前,可以通过社交媒体或论坛向社区发布合约测试版,接受用户的反馈,从而发现更深层次的问题。
  4. 使用成熟的合约模板:借用已经被广泛使用并验证过的合约模板或开源合约,可以大大减少安全风险。
  5. 定期维护与更新:虽然合约在区块链上是不可变的,但可以定期发布新版本的合约,替换旧合约,保证新版本更安全。

合约上架的费用和时间是怎样的?

合约上架的费用和时间因不同平台和合约复杂程度而有所不同。一般而言,上架tpWallet自身是免费的,但在部署合约时,用户需要支付一定的网络费用,例如在以太坊网络中,用户需支付天然气费用(Gas fee)。

具体费用如下:

  1. 网络费用:这部分费用受市场的影响,可能会有波动,用户需要查看当时的网络状况来评估费用。
  2. 审计费用:如果选择第三方进行代码审计,这部分费用由审计公司确定,一般的费用从几百到几千美元不等。
  3. 其他费用:根据tpWallet的政策,如需要提供额外的服务(如市场宣传、技术支持),可能需要支付额外的服务费用。

作为合约上架的时间,首先是合约开发和测试需要的时间,通常1-2周;其次是审核时期,tpWallet的审核时间一般在1-3个工作日,但具体情况会因合约的复杂度不同而有所差异。如需提供重大的修改和调整,审核时间也可能相应延长。

用户如何使用上架的合约?

合约一旦在tpWallet上架,用户可以通过tpWallet进行相应的操作。这包括查看合约信息、进行交易、参与合约中的活动等。具体使用方法包括:

  1. 添加合约到钱包:用户可以手动输入合约地址,添加到他们的tpWallet中以进行管理。
  2. 执行交易:用户在tpWallet中可以直接执行合约的函数,例如购买资产、进行质押等,具体使用界面以合约功能为准。
  3. 进行转账:用户可以将合约中的资产进行转账,同样需要相应的手续费。
  4. 参与活动:部分合约可能会定期举行活动,用户可以在tpWallet中查看活动信息,参与相应的活动。

同时tpWallet会提供相关的使用说明和帮助文档,以便用户轻松上手。

上架合约的常见问题

1. 合约上架后,如何处理用户反馈和问题?

合约上线后,用户的反馈是非常重要的一点,良好的用户体验能够吸引更多的用户。对待用户反馈,可以从以下几个方面着手:

  1. 设立反馈渠道:在合约页面或官方网站上提供反馈入口。用户可以通过邮件、论坛、社交媒体等多种渠道反馈问题,这样可以快速收集反馈信息。
  2. 定期查看反馈:合约上线后的反馈应定期收集和整理,识别出更多用户共同关注的问题。一般用户反馈将分为功能性问题和体验性问题,针对性解决。
  3. 快速响应问题:对于较为紧急的问题,及时给予用户反馈和解决方案。如果是安全性问题,需进行快速处理,必要时暂停合约交易,保护用户资产。
  4. 持续改进:用户的反馈对于后续的改版或升级是非常宝贵的信息。可以据此不断改进合约功能,提升用户体验。
  5. 用户社区:构建一个用户社区,让用户可以交流使用体验和问题,形成良好的互动发展。

2. 如何确保合约的可操作性和用户体验?

若想确保合约的可操作性和用户体验,需要从多个维度考虑:

  1. 界面设计:合约相关的网页或应用界面应简洁易用。设计时需多考虑用户的使用习惯,降低操作门槛。
  2. 功能完善:根据用户反馈,及时和添加更多的功能,例如增加导入合约的便捷方法,支持更多的资产转移。
  3. 教程和帮助:提供详细的使用教程和帮助文档,用户可以在遇到问题时立即找寻解决方案。
  4. 联系客服:在必要时提供实时在线客服或支持,以便用户在使用中遇到问题可以及时获得帮助。
  5. 定期更新:保持合约的定期更新,改进功能和安全性,回应用户的需求,不断提高用户体验。

3. 如何对合约的性能进行监控?

合约上线后,为了确保其正常运作并提供良好的用户体验,需要对合约的性能进行监控:

  1. 监控合约调用:利用区块链浏览器等工具监控合约的调用情况,包括交易次数和金额等,以评估合约的受欢迎程度。
  2. 记录交易数据:记录历史交易数据,以便未来可分析合约使用情况,了解用户行为和习惯。
  3. 监管异常活动:利用算法监测合约使用中的异常活动,例如某些地址在短时间内频繁调用合约等,这可能表明存在安全风险。
  4. 用户反馈:主动向用户咨询使用体验以获取反馈。可以利用问卷调查等方式收集用户意见,评估合约性能。
  5. 设置报警机制:对于特定的预期指标设置预警,一旦指标异常,就可及时处理或者通知相关团队。

4. 上架合约后如何进行市场推广?

合约上线后,进行市场推广是吸引用户使用合约的关键环节。可采取以下措施:

  1. 社交媒体宣传:利用Twitter、Telegram等社交媒体平台进行宣传,可以创建官方账号,发布合约进展、使用指南、操作体验等,吸引用户关注。
  2. 社区互动:积极参与区块链相关的社区,定期分享合约的最新动态,发展忠实用户群体。
  3. 内容营销:撰写与合约相关的文章、视频教程、使用案例等,通过内容营销吸引潜在用户。
  4. 发布奖励活动:可以通过引入奖励机制,鼓励用户参与合约活动,例如首次使用奖励、推荐奖励等,增加用户粘性。
  5. 合作伙伴推广:与其他项目进行合作,互相推广。通过整合资源,可以实现共赢和用户互动。

5. 合约上架后,如何进行后期维护?

合约上架后,后期维护是确保合约长久运行的核心,主要可以从以下几个方面进行:

  1. 安全检查:持续监测合约的安全性,尤其是其他新出现的安全漏洞,确保用户资产的安全。
  2. 技术支持:提供用户技术支持,解答使用中的问题,确保合约的平稳运行。
  3. 功能迭代:根据用户反馈和市场需求,不断迭代合约功能。在合约中加入新特性,提高竞争力。
  4. 监控使用情况:定期分析合约的使用数据,以确定合约的受欢迎程度及用户的需求,从而指导后续的工作。
  5. 持续沟通:与用户保持良好的沟通,以便及时了解用户的需求变化,制定相应的改进计划。

综上所述,合约上架到tpWallet不仅是一个技术操作,还需要关注合约安全性、用户体验、运营维护等多个方面。通过制定合理的策略和计划,可以有效吸引用户,提升合约的使用价值和影响力。